**Q: Snapshot tests for Lumenkit UI components are failing after a dependency bump — what now?**

First, regenerate snapshots locally and inspect the diff carefully; cosmetic class-name churn is expected, layout shifts are not. If the snapshot vault used by the Perlin CI runner refuses to unlock, you will need to restore access manually. Use the recovery passphrase below.

vault phrase of bagaf-kajeg = jorath-feniel-briir-siliel-ralix

## Local Setup

The Bramblewick catalogue importer ingests MARC-style records from the Dunhollow consortium feed and normalises them into our holdings tables. Before running it locally, create the `catalogue_stage` schema with `make migrate-stage`, then run `bwick import --dry-run` to validate the sample batch without writing anything. Pay attention to duplicate-accession warnings; they usually indicate a stale staging table. Once the dry run is clean, point the importer at the staging database using the connection string below.

replica DSN, kajep-yahag: mssql://praok_svc:iF@db-8d68.plorvaio.local:5432/eliion

Visitors to the Lumenreel recording studio on level 2 must be accompanied at all times by a Brightfold staff member. Please keep noise to a minimum in the corridor, as sessions run throughout the day. New starters may enter the studio for orientation tours using the code below.

badge for yajep-tawip: bdg-UBYAH-39947

Leadership Review Briefing — Regional Sales, Fennory Beverages. Quick read for the board: the Westmoor region carried the quarter, up 14% on strong café accounts, while Dellhaven slipped 6% after a distributor change. The new Sunridge sparkling line is landing well in smaller towns, less so in the cities. Marla Quent's team is reworking the urban pitch. Overall we're on plan, just unevenly so. Full figures in the appendix pack. The confidential note on business plans sits just below this briefing.

internal memo for yahag-tahog: The pricing group signed off on a budget of $152.8 million for Project Soriel.